首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Django搜索未显示结果

Django是一个基于Python的开源Web应用框架,它提供了一套完整的开发工具和功能,用于快速构建高效的Web应用程序。在Django中进行搜索时,如果未显示结果,可能是由于以下几个原因:

  1. 数据库中没有匹配的记录:搜索功能通常需要与数据库交互,如果数据库中没有与搜索条件匹配的记录,那么就不会显示结果。可以检查数据库中的数据是否正确,并确保搜索条件与数据库中的字段匹配。
  2. 搜索条件不正确:搜索功能通常需要指定搜索条件,如果搜索条件不正确或不完整,就可能导致未显示结果。可以检查搜索条件的语法和逻辑是否正确,并确保搜索条件与数据库中的字段匹配。
  3. 搜索功能实现有误:搜索功能的实现可能存在错误,导致未显示结果。可以检查搜索功能的代码逻辑是否正确,并确保搜索功能能够正确地从数据库中检索数据并显示结果。
  4. 搜索结果未正确渲染:即使搜索功能能够正确地从数据库中检索数据,但如果结果未正确渲染到前端页面,也会导致未显示结果。可以检查前端页面的代码逻辑是否正确,并确保搜索结果能够正确地显示在页面上。

对于Django搜索功能,腾讯云提供了云数据库MySQL和云数据库PostgreSQL等产品,可以作为Django应用程序的后端数据库存储解决方案。您可以通过以下链接了解更多关于腾讯云数据库产品的信息:

同时,腾讯云还提供了云服务器、云函数、云存储等产品,可以用于支持Django应用程序的部署、运行和存储等需求。您可以通过以下链接了解更多关于腾讯云产品的信息:

请注意,以上仅为腾讯云提供的一些相关产品,其他云计算品牌商也提供类似的产品和解决方案,可以根据具体需求选择适合的云计算服务提供商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券